Default colorful envelopes

So I was lucky enough to be in Houston when Hobby Lobby had cards and envelopes on sale and was able to get colorful envelopes instead of just white! Here in my town with only one Hobby Lobby the colors are always sold out before I can get to the store....confounding I tell ya!
Does anyone shop for envelopes in colors other than white or cream? Where to find bright colored ones?

Have you thought of making your own? I purchase colored copy paper and make my own. It's easy and I custom color it and make it to that particular card. I use some of the two sided tear away tape for the envelope and peel and seal when I'm ready. Colored copy paper is way cheaper then prepared envelopes. Just a thought.

Yes, I have made my own envelopes in the past. I have the envelope punch board, but I make a lot of cards and really don't want to have to make all the envelopes! I did just buy Neenah Creative Collection 32 lb colored paper at Office Depot for $5.99 for 48 sheets...works out to slightly over .12 cents per envelope.
When I buy envelopes at Hobby Lobby at 50% off, I get 25 envelopes for $2.50 which makes them .10 cents each...
